So what's the ranking of the QB's from this draft class looking like now?
Round 1, No. 2 overall: Mitchell Trubisky, North Carolina
Round 1, No. 10 overall: Patrick Mahomes II, Texas Tech
Round 1, No. 12 overall: Deshaun Watson, Clemson
Round 2, 52 overall: DeShone Kizer, Notre Dame
Round 3, 87th overall: Davis Webb, California
Round 3, 104th overall: C.J. Beathard, Iowa
Round 4, 135th overall: Joshua Dobbs, Tennessee
Round 5, 171st overall: Nathan Peterman, Pittsburgh
Round 6, 215th overall: Brad Kaaya, Miami
Round 7, 253rd overall: Chad Kelly, Ole Miss
